What Is an Audio Amplifier Circuit?

An audio amplifier takes a low-power sound signal (like from a mobile, MP3 player, or mic) and boosts it to a level that can operate a speaker. The stronger the amplified signal, the better and louder the output.

There are many types of amplifier circuits such as Class A, B, AB, and Class D, but simple DIY circuits commonly use ICs like LM386, TDA2030, TDA7297, or TPA3116.

Best Amplifier ICs for DIY Projects

  • LM386 — For small speakers & headphone amps

  • TDA2030 / TDA2050 — For medium-powered DIY speakers

  • TDA7297 — Dual-channel mini amplifier

  • TPA3116 — High-power Class D amplifier

  • C5200/A1943 — For high-power audio projects
